Embedded Systems

Integration eines LISA-basierten ARM-Prozessormodells in ein On-Chip-Bussystem

As­signed to Y. Runge.

Bach­e­lor’s The­sis

Ab­stract

Die vor­liegende Bach­e­lo­rar­beit setzt sich mit einem in LISA geschriebe­nen Mod­ell des ARM Cor­tex-M3 Prozes­sors au­seinan­der. Es wird das beste­hende Sin­gle-Cy­cle-Mem­ory-Mod­ell durch ein Mul­ti­ple-Cy­cle-Mem­ory-Mod­ell er­setzt, wobei die Kom­mu­nika­tion mit dem neuen Spe­icher­mod­ell über das AHBPro­tokoll er­folgt. Hi­erzu wird das alte Spe­icher­mod­ell durch ein neues aus­ge­tauscht, eine Kom­mu­nika­tion­ss­chnittstelle für den neuen Spe­icher geschaf­fen und die Zu­griff­s­logik des ARM Cor­tex-M3 dahinge­hend er­weit­ert, dass er das neue Mod­ell un­terstützt.

Es wurde hi­er­bei nicht das AHB-Pro­tkoll, son­dern das AHB-Lite-Pro­tokoll im­ple­men­tiert, wobei die Zu­griff­s­logik und Kom­mu­nika­tion­ss­chnittstellen auf das AHB-Lite-Pro­tokoll aus­gerichtet sind.

Als Ergeb­nis der Ar­beit kann fest­ge­hal­ten wer­den, dass die Zu­griff­s­logik und die Kom­mu­nika­tion­ss­chnittstellen ko­r­rekt im­ple­men­tiert wur­den, was durch ver­schiedene Sim­u­la­tion ver­i­fiziert wurde.

Con­tact

Bring­mann, Oliver

Pe­ter­son, Dustin